Transaction 28b3010686facb6192a21d79a0186b05504ab4af21fbf378057c874547b6218e

1 Input
2 Outputs
  • 28b3010686facb6192a21d79a0186b05504ab4af21fbf378057c874547b6218e:0
  • value  112967603
    address  1EmiXKX72DRxjMimu6FMuWNxaECoh6QfC
  • 28b3010686facb6192a21d79a0186b05504ab4af21fbf378057c874547b6218e:1
  • value  2535530
    address  3DVhPqp6zM5mCKhXSEHsV2V5R2PjwzEx6X